Offered by University of Bedfordshire, the BA (Hons) Sport, Coaching and Physical Education provides a comprehensive undergraduate education in biological sciences. Based in Bedford, England, this programme combines theoretical knowledge with practical application, with a 3-year full-time structure. This wide-ranging course gives you the flexibility to choose a sociological or health pathway, allowing you to specialise in your final year of study. Led by an academic team at the cutting edge of teaching and research in this field, your learning combines theory of teaching and lab work with practical activities including an exciting outdoor and adventure education experience. You experience working with and teaching children through on-campus visits from schools or community work. International tuition fees are £16,900 per year, home/UK fees are £9,790 per year, and a minimum IELTS score of 6.0 is required for admission. Graduates from this programme benefit from strong career prospects, with a median graduate salary of £23,000 within three years.

Graduate Outcomes
Based on official HESA Graduate Outcomes survey data
💰 Graduate Salaries — University of Bedfordshire
| Time After Graduation | Lower Quartile Salary | Median Salary | Upper Quartile Salary |
|---|---|---|---|
| 15 months | £22,000 | £23,000 | £27,000 |
| 3 years | £17,500 | £23,000 | £27,000 |
| 5 years | £22,500 | £27,500 | £34,000 |
UK subject average: £25,000 — sector benchmark across all UK universities
Graduate Salary vs UK Subject Average
Salary trend: ↑ up £4,500 from year 3 to year 5
